From aca0fb6f1d700634df3ca98dc02209da8ce7311a Mon Sep 17 00:00:00 2001 From: Gonzalo Rodriguez Date: Thu, 21 Jun 2018 14:59:27 -0300 Subject: [PATCH] Clarify in gemspec existence of two group of semantically distict dev deps --- rack-attack.gemspec | 15 +++++++++------ 1 file changed, 9 insertions(+), 6 deletions(-) diff --git a/rack-attack.gemspec b/rack-attack.gemspec index eb9336a..a021f10 100644 --- a/rack-attack.gemspec +++ b/rack-attack.gemspec @@ -25,17 +25,11 @@ Gem::Specification.new do |s| s.add_dependency 'rack' - s.add_development_dependency 'actionpack', '>= 3.0.0' - s.add_development_dependency 'activesupport', '>= 3.0.0' s.add_development_dependency 'appraisal' - s.add_development_dependency 'connection_pool' - s.add_development_dependency 'dalli' - s.add_development_dependency 'memcache-client' s.add_development_dependency 'minitest' s.add_development_dependency "minitest-stub-const" s.add_development_dependency 'rack-test' s.add_development_dependency 'rake' - s.add_development_dependency 'redis-activesupport' s.add_development_dependency "rubocop", "0.57.2" s.add_development_dependency "timecop" @@ -43,4 +37,13 @@ Gem::Specification.new do |s| if RUBY_ENGINE == "ruby" s.add_development_dependency 'byebug' end + + # The following are potential runtime dependencies users may have, + # which rack-attack uses only for testing compatibility in test suite. + s.add_development_dependency 'actionpack', '>= 3.0.0' + s.add_development_dependency 'activesupport', '>= 3.0.0' + s.add_development_dependency 'connection_pool' + s.add_development_dependency 'dalli' + s.add_development_dependency 'memcache-client' + s.add_development_dependency 'redis-activesupport' end